Cüce sıralaması (İngilizcesi: Gnome sort), bilgisayar bilimlerinde kullanılan araya sokmalı sıralamaya benzer bir sıralama algoritmasıdır. Ara sokmalı sıralamadan farkı kabarcık sıralaması yönteminde olduğu gibi, bir elemanın sıralanan dizideki yerine birçok yer değiştirme yoluyla gelmesidir. Cüce Sıralaması adı algoritmanın yönteminin mitolojideki Hollanda cücelerinin (gnome) bir dizi çiçek saksısını sıraya diziş biçimine benzemesinden kaynaklanmaktadır.
Sözde Kodu
function gnomeSort(a[0..size-1]) { i := 1 j := 2 while i < size - 1 if a[i-1] >= a[i] i := j j := j + 1 else swap a[i-1] and a[i] i := i - 1 if i = 0 i := 1 }
Algoritmanın Java Uygulaması
void gnomeSort(int a[]) { int i = 1; int j = 2; while (i < a.length - 1) {; if (a[i - 1] >= a[i]) {; i = j; j++;
} else { int temp = a[i]; a[i] = a[i - 1]; a[i - 1] = tempe; i--; if (i == 0) { i = 1; } } }
Dış bağlantılar
- Cüce Sıralaması25 Nisan 2008 tarihinde Wayback Machine sitesinde .
Yazılım ile ilgili bu madde seviyesindedir. Madde içeriğini genişleterek Vikipedi'ye katkı sağlayabilirsiniz. |
wikipedia, wiki, viki, vikipedia, oku, kitap, kütüphane, kütübhane, ara, ara bul, bul, herşey, ne arasanız burada,hikayeler, makale, kitaplar, öğren, wiki, bilgi, tarih, yukle, izle, telefon için, turk, türk, türkçe, turkce, nasıl yapılır, ne demek, nasıl, yapmak, yapılır, indir, ücretsiz, ücretsiz indir, bedava, bedava indir, mp3, video, mp4, 3gp, jpg, jpeg, gif, png, resim, müzik, şarkı, film, film, oyun, oyunlar, mobil, cep telefonu, telefon, android, ios, apple, samsung, iphone, xiomi, xiaomi, redmi, honor, oppo, nokia, sonya, mi, pc, web, computer, bilgisayar
Cuce siralamasi Ingilizcesi Gnome sort bilgisayar bilimlerinde kullanilan araya sokmali siralamaya benzer bir siralama algoritmasidir Ara sokmali siralamadan farki kabarcik siralamasi yonteminde oldugu gibi bir elemanin siralanan dizideki yerine bircok yer degistirme yoluyla gelmesidir Cuce Siralamasi adi algoritmanin yonteminin mitolojideki Hollanda cucelerinin gnome bir dizi cicek saksisini siraya dizis bicimine benzemesinden kaynaklanmaktadir Sozde Kodufunction gnomeSort a 0 size 1 i 1 j 2 while i lt size 1 if a i 1 gt a i i j j j 1 else swap a i 1 and a i i i 1 if i 0 i 1 Algoritmanin Java Uygulamasivoid gnomeSort int a int i 1 int j 2 while i lt a length 1 if a i 1 gt a i i j j else int temp a i a i a i 1 a i 1 tempe i if i 0 i 1 Dis baglantilarCuce Siralamasi25 Nisan 2008 tarihinde Wayback Machine sitesinde Yazilim ile ilgili bu madde taslak seviyesindedir Madde icerigini genisleterek Vikipedi ye katki saglayabilirsiniz